Gothams Pocket 7-4 Win Against Houston
New York Gothams starter Curtis Robinson pitched well against the Houston Comets at Gotham Stadium, leading his team to a win, 7-4. Robinson got the win, improving to 7-9. He gave up 9 hits and walked 2 over 8.2 innings. He allowed 4 runs. The Gothams improved their record to 43-52 with the win over Houston.

Earl Ferry had a big 2-run home run for the Gothams in the bottom of the sixth inning. With New York leading 3-2 and a runner on 1st, he sized up a sinker from Jay Hunt, who leads the FA with a 2.13 ERA, and punished it. The result was his 7th home run of the season, which put the Gothams on top, 5-2.

"There's still time to turn this season around," said Ferry.
